Infineon TLE8366EV33XUMA1: A 3V Low-Dropout Voltage Regulator for Automotive Applications
In the demanding world of automotive electronics, where components must operate reliably under extreme temperatures, voltage fluctuations, and harsh electromagnetic conditions, power management becomes a critical design challenge. Addressing this need, Infineon Technologies has developed the TLE8366EV33XUMA1, a highly robust 3.3V low-dropout (LDO) voltage regulator engineered specifically for the automotive environment.
This monolithic integrated circuit is designed to provide a stable and clean 3.3V output voltage from a vehicle's battery supply, which can typically range from 3.5V to a punishing 40V. The device's low dropout voltage is a key feature, enabling it to continue regulating its output even when the input voltage dips very close to the output level. This is essential during critical automotive events like cold-cranking, when the battery voltage can plummet dramatically.

The TLE8366EV33XUMA1 excels in reliability and diagnostic capability. It integrates a comprehensive suite of protection features, including overload, short-circuit, and over-temperature protection, safeguarding both the regulator itself and the sensitive microcontroller or ASIC it powers. Furthermore, it offers vital diagnostic feedback through an error flag pin, which alerts the system's main processor to abnormal conditions such as an output voltage drop, enhancing the overall safety and functional security of the application.
Its primary use cases are vast within a modern vehicle, often serving as a local power supply for microcontrollers, sensors, and ASICs in systems like body control modules, instrument clusters, and adv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S). The device's excellent elect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) performance and very low quiescent current make it an ideal choice for both always-on and ignition-switched power rails.
Housed in a space-saving PG-SOT223-4 package, the regulator is also AEC-Q100 qualified, guaranteeing its performance across the automotive temperature range of -40°C to 150°C junction temperature. This certification is a mandatory requirement for components used in automotive systems, underscoring its suitability for the most rigorous applications.
